Seite 1 von 1

eps+tex(psfrag) -> dvi -> ps -> pdf: Papiergröße?

Verfasst: Do 26. Mai 2011, 10:27
von epfi
Moin!

Folgende Situation: ein Satz Bilder als eps mit jeweils zugehörigem tex-file, das mir per psfrag die Text-Platzhalter in meinen Bildern mit dem richtigen Text ersetzt.

Würde ich nun latex benutzen, wäre das kein Problem, da könnte ich die Bilder einfach so einbinden. Ich benutze aber pdflatex (was kein eps mag) und würde das auch gerne weiterhin tun.

Also hab ich mir gedacht, dass ich die Bilder wie im Titel beschrieben nach pdf konvertiere und dann in mein pdflatex-dokument einbinde. Problem bei der Sache: im eps gibt es die Bounding-Box noch. Aber spätestens, nachdem das durch latex gelaufen ist, wird das Bild ja auf einer A4- (oder sonstwie gearteten) Seite abgelegt und die Bounding Box ist weg.
Das führt in letzter Instanz dazu, dass mein PDF ein A4-Blatt ist, wo (mehr oder weniger irgendwo) das Bild draufsitzt. Zum Einbinden also völlig ungeeignet.

Gibt es irgendeinen cleveren Trick, dass meine Seite im tex-file (wo das Bild drinsitzt) so groß wird, wie das Bild? Eine Kantenlänge des Bildes muss ich ja ohnehin vorgeben, die andere Seite ergibt sich dann von selbst. Im Prinzip wäre mir schon geholfen, wenn ich das Seitenverhältnis des eps schon in der Präambel kennen würde, dann könnte ich die endgültige Größe ausrechnen und das Papierformat entsprechend anpassen.

Vielleicht hat ja jemand ne clevere Idee dazu.

Grüße
Markus

Verfasst: So 29. Mai 2011, 23:54
von michl1211
Hallo,

welches Betriebssystem verwendest Du? Grundsätzlich würde ich vorschlagen die .eps-Dateien in einem LaTeX-Externen Programm in .pdf-Dateien umzuwandeln. Der Shell-Befehl epstopdf Dateiname.eps wandelt eine .eps-Datei in eine .pdf-Datei um ohne dabei die Abmessungen der Datei zu zerstören - falls das das Problem ist.

Verfasst: Mo 30. Mai 2011, 08:48
von KOMA
Ich vermute, das Problem ist die Verwendung von psfrag mit pdflatex. Ganz sicher bin ich mir aber nicht. Die Frage ist für mich nach mehrmaligem Lesen noch immer weitgehend konfus. Falls das das Problem ist: http://www.ctan.org/pkg/auto-pst-pdf.

Natürlich kann man auch den Weg latex, dvips, pstopdf/ps2pdf oder latex, dvipdfmx für das gesamte Dokument gehen.

Verfasst: Mo 30. Mai 2011, 09:29
von epfi
Sorry, dass mein Posting etwas konfus ist - je länger ich mir das angucke, desto verdrehter werde ich im Kopf...

Das Problem ist tatsächlich die Benutzung von psfrag, was eine einfache Konvertierung mit epstopdf unmöglich macht.

Allerdings habe ich gestern Nacht noch psfragfig entdeckt, was ja genau das tut, was ich möchte. Hakelt gerade noch ein bisschen, aber das bekomme ich auch noch in den Griff...

Vielen Dank für die Antworten :)

Markus